- A Plant City brush fire sparked Monday afternoon after a controlled burn got out of control. Hillsborough County Fire Rescue said crews responded at around 2 p.m. to the "rapidly spreading" brush fire off of Mary Ivy Drive. They said a 911 caller told them the fire began as a controlled burn that quickly got out of control, overwhelming the homeowner trying to manage it.
